When Moses said to his (assisting) youth: 'I will not give up until I reach the point where the two seas meet even though I should go on for many years' 60 But when they reached the junction between them, they forgot their fish, and it took its course into the sea, slipping away. 61 But when they had gone farther, he said to his servant: Bring to us our morning meal, certainly we have met with fatigue from this our journey. 62 He said, "Did you see when we retired to the rock? Indeed, I forgot [there] the fish. And none made me forget it except Satan - that I should mention it. And it took its course into the sea amazingly". 63 [Moses] exclaimed: "That [was the place] which we were seeking! And the two turned back, retracing their footsetps, 64 Then they found one of Our votaries, whom We had blessed and given knowledge from Us. 65 Moses said unto him: May I follow thee, to the end that thou mayst teach me right conduct of that which thou hast been taught? 66 [The other] answered: "Behold, thou wilt never be able to have patience with me 67 for how couldst thou be patient about something that thou canst not comprehend within the compass of [thy] experience?" 68 [Moses] said, "You will find me, if Allah wills, patient, and I will not disobey you in [any] order." 69 He said: "Well, if you follow me, do not ask me concerning anything until I myself mention it to you." 70
